NYC building collapses after blast, fire By ADAM GOLDMAN, Associated Press Writer
9 minutes ago


NEW YORK - A three-story building housing a doctor's office just off Madison Avenue collapsed and burned Monday after what witnesses said was a thunderous explosion that rocked the neighborhood.

The cause was not immediately known, though White House press secretary Tony Snow said there was no indication of terrorism.

At least two people were under evaluation at a hospital after the collapse. It wasn't immediately clear if anyone was still trapped inside the building, on 62nd street between Madison and Park Avenues on Manhattan's East Side.
